    Buildah is a tool for creating OCI-compliant container images without requiring a background daemon process. It functions as a daemonless image constructor and distribution tool, allowing users to build, push, and pull images between local storage and remote registries. The project distinguishes itself by supporting unprivileged image building through the use of user namespaces and rootless mode. It enables direct modification of container root filesystems by mounting them to the host, allowing images to be treated as directories that can be manipulated via standard shell commands or scripts.
